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Hierarchy of Developer Needs -- adapting when t...
Search
juliaferraioli
September 25, 2014
Technology
2
2.5k
Hierarchy of Developer Needs -- adapting when things go wrong
Keynote at APIStrat Chicago 2014
juliaferraioli
September 25, 2014
Tweet
Share
More Decks by juliaferraioli
See All by juliaferraioli
Exploring the World Using Cloud Vision & Twilio
juliaferraioli
0
1.4k
Blocks in containers
juliaferraioli
2
1.5k
Diving into Machine Learning with TensorFlow
juliaferraioli
5
2.1k
In the Name of Whiskey
juliaferraioli
0
1.6k
When am I ever going to use this? ...tales from a career in industry
juliaferraioli
1
1.4k
1-Up Your DevOps Workflow
juliaferraioli
3
1.5k
cluster management, cognitive shifts, & kubernetes
juliaferraioli
1
1.6k
The W's of Diversity
juliaferraioli
2
2.9k
Hierarchy of Developer Needs
juliaferraioli
0
2.6k
Other Decks in Technology
See All in Technology
誰も全体を知らない ~ ロールの垣根を超えて引き上げる開発生産性 / Boosting Development Productivity Across Roles
kakehashi
2
230
BLADE: An Attempt to Automate Penetration Testing Using Autonomous AI Agents
bbrbbq
0
330
初心者向けAWS Securityの勉強会mini Security-JAWSを9ヶ月ぐらい実施してきての近況
cmusudakeisuke
0
130
Lambda10周年!Lambdaは何をもたらしたか
smt7174
2
130
VideoMamba: State Space Model for Efficient Video Understanding
chou500
0
190
DynamoDB でスロットリングが発生したとき/when_throttling_occurs_in_dynamodb_short
emiki
0
270
Storybook との上手な向き合い方を考える
re_taro
5
770
ノーコードデータ分析ツールで体験する時系列データ分析超入門
negi111111
0
430
心が動くエンジニアリング ── 私が夢中になる理由
16bitidol
0
100
Taming you application's environments
salaboy
0
200
開発生産性を上げながらビジネスも30倍成長させてきたチームの姿
kamina_zzz
2
1.7k
Making your applications cross-environment - OSCG 2024 NA
salaboy
0
200
Featured
See All Featured
KATA
mclloyd
29
14k
Principles of Awesome APIs and How to Build Them.
keavy
126
17k
Reflections from 52 weeks, 52 projects
jeffersonlam
346
20k
Building Adaptive Systems
keathley
38
2.3k
Scaling GitHub
holman
458
140k
Rebuilding a faster, lazier Slack
samanthasiow
79
8.7k
Into the Great Unknown - MozCon
thekraken
32
1.5k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
232
17k
Building an army of robots
kneath
302
43k
[RailsConf 2023] Rails as a piece of cake
palkan
52
4.9k
Designing for humans not robots
tammielis
250
25k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
109
49k
Transcript
Hierarchy of Developer Needs Julia Ferraioli Senior Developer Maslow Advocate
@juliaferraioli google.com/+JuliaFerraioli
Financial gain Shiny objects Respect and recognition Utilitarianism Socialization Self
improvement What drives my community?
Creative Commons image courtesy of Luc Galoppin
Image courtesy of my bad planning
But I’m a developer! I know what my developers need.
Creative Commons image courtesy of Duncan Hull
My mistake Reference docs Code samples Tutorials Discussion forum Online
courses
This works... sometimes
Developer Profiles Enthusiasts Founder Enterprise Engineer
No one hierarchy to rule them all Image used with
permission of of Mirach Ravaia
Back to the mistake Reference docs Code samples Tutorials Discussion
forum Online courses
Time to shuffle Online courses Tutorials Libraries, SDKs, gems Code
samples Reference docs
Time to shuffle Reference docs Paid support Code samples Online
courses Libraries
Time to shuffle
Debugging your hierarchy
gdb devexp
Creative Commons image courtesy of Olga Mismatched...expectations
You have to ask your developers • Hit the pavement
• Structured engagement • Informal engagement • Research (costly)
What are the obstacles? • Cognitive disconnect • Lack of
direction • Absence of trust • Problematic community Creative Commons image courtesy of Grant Montgomery
Creative Commons image courtesy of Thomson Safaris Plan of Attack
Creative Commons image courtesy of Arne Hendriks
Thanks! Images by Connie Zhou @juliaferraioli google.com/+JuliaFerraioli
Creative Commons image courtesy of David Ashleydale